Transaction 50a4cf4100eddbda8cd67872c8e174121069319c5d640ad73897c1d853887765
1 Input
1 Output
-
50a4cf4100eddbda8cd67872c8e174121069319c5d640ad73897c1d853887765:0
- value
- 15392
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d653ee0f66ae9b3ed1c207f513ed3b69f087ca6c OP_EQUAL
- address
- 3MEH59aXMpHXbX7vMgca6hRTLCGKc7hUJv